Atlantic City, New Jersey (DERRINGER COMMUNICATIONS) -

The Greatest 70's Show Ever! Disco Ball 2006
Presented by KTU 103.5 FM and Vito Bruno
Saturday, June 10, 2006. 7PM Show (sold out) & Midnight Show Added.
Donald Trump's Taj Mahal Hotel and Casino in Atlantic City, New Jersey
Tickets Available at ticketmaster.com

Vito Bruno has been producing music industry events, concerts and radio station events across the United States for several decades. He has been part of every musical genre as a manager, producer and promoter. Mr. Bruno has achieved an impressive 50 number one records in the Billboard charts. He is also responsible for Beatstock, the largest dance music concert ever assembled in America with 52 acts on stage (currently in the Guinness Book of World Records for the most number one songs performed in one concert by the original artists). The Disco Ball and past events are just a taste of what's to come, as this leader of the industry truly takes his place among entertainments best. This year¹s Disco Ball promises to be better than ever, as Mr. Bruno plans to raise the bar yet again.

Performing:
Gloria Gaynor: 'I Will Survive,' 'Never Can Say Goodbye,' "Honeybee'
Irene Cara: 'What a Feeling,' 'Fame'
Tavarres: 'It Only Takes a Minute Girl,' "Heaven Must Be Missing an Angel,' 'More Than a Woman,' 'Don't Take Away the Music'
Hues Corp: 'Rock The Boat,' 'I Caught Your Act'
Santa Esmeralda: 'Don't Let Me Be Misunderstood'
Lenny Gomez: 'You're My Everything' (1st Appearance in 20 years)
Evelyn Champagne King: 'Shame,' 'I'm In Love,' 'Love Come Down'
Linda Clifford: 'If My Friends Could See Me Now,' 'Runaway Love'
Loleatta Holloway: 'Love Sensation' 'Relight My Fire'
France Joli: 'Heart to Break a Heart,' 'Come To Me,' 'Let Go,' 'Gonna Get Over You,' 'Don't Stop Dancing'
Trammps: "Disco Inferno,' 'Where Were You,' 'Hooked For Life," 'Zing With The Strings Of My Heart' 'Hold Back the Night'
Sugar Hill Gang: 'Rappers Delight,' '8th Wonder'
Jeff & Edell - formerly of Lime: 'Babe, We're Gonna Love Tonight,' 'Your Love,' 'Guilty,' 'Come Get Your Love,' 'Angel Eyes'
Hosts: Sherman Helmsey from The Jeffersons and Joe Gannascoli from HBO's The Sopranos
